> Convert hugetlb_get_unmapped_area_new_pmd() to use vm_unmapped_area()
> rather than searching the virtual address space itself. This fixes the
> following errors in linux-next due to the specified members being
> removed after other architectures have already been converted:

Looks good. Just one thing, which I don't have full context to evaluate:

> +       info.align_mask = PAGE_MASK & HUGEPT_MASK;

This will work only if HUGEPT_MASK == HUGEPT_SIZE - 1, as opposed to
the PAGE_MASK definition which is ~(PAGE_SIZE - 1).
Not sure how HUGEPT_MASK is defined, so please double check that.
